Hi Jeff's Cub: That is the data plate with the IH Kind/Code/Serial number...

0032 = mower deck
0016 = factory code for which version (bearings were different)
U = manufactured at a US plant
102209 = the one-up serial number

The 0016 deck should probably be a 42 or 48 inch deck made between 1968 & 1971. The 0016 deck does NOT use the ST-745 water pump style bearings. It uses a modern style spindle with roller bearings.

To obtain the deck size, measure the widest distance between the outer blades (cutting width).
